   European Stars And Stripes (Newspaper) - September 6, 1986, Darmstadt, Hesse                                Saturday september 6,198b  and stripes Page 21 sports sex Tiger Greenberg Dies at 75 Beverly Hills Calif. A Hank Greenberg whose Home run prowess with the Detroit tigers put him in baseball s Hall of Fame die thursday at age 7 5. Greenberg died at his Home after suffering from cancer for 13 months according to a statement issued by Arn Tellem Law partner of Grcen Borg s son Stephen. Greenberg who was the american league s map in 1935 and 1940, finished his career with 331 Home runs and a .313 Balling average. He hit 58 homers in 1938. He was an owner and executive of the Cleveland indians from 1948 through 1998 and a vice president of the Chicago White so from 1959 through i960. He is survived by his wife Mary to two sons one daughter two Broth ers a sister and eight grandchildren. Jim Campbell president and chief executive officer of the tigers issued a statement thai said Hank Green Berg was a tribute to baseball on and off the Field. He was one of the most feared Home run hitters of All time. Later he proved to be equally productive As a baseball executive. More than anything though he was a gentleman. The tigers and All of baseball will miss him " Greenbey career in i. Whom he played 12 of his 13 seasons. He missed three seasons 1942, 43 and 44 because of world War ii and finished his career in 1947 with the Pittsburgh pirates. He was bom Henry Benjamin arc Enburg on Jan. 1, 1911 in the Bronx in new York City. Funeral services will be private in All my years of being on the erg began his major league 1930 with the tigers for Hank Greenberg Hallof Famer playing Field i never dreamed that this would be the final result Green Berg said at his Hall of Fame in Shn nement in 1956. I can t possibly express How 1 feel. It s just Loo wonderful for words. Greenberg a first baseman and outfielder led the american league in homers and Bis four times. His Besl season was 1938 when in Addi Tion to hitting 58 homers he drove in146 runs. That year he also scored 144 runs and Drew 119 walks both league leading figures. His homers Hal year were Only two shy of the record Sci in 1927 by babe Ruth and subsequently broken in 1961, when Roger Mam hit 61. Before Green Beig. Jimmy Foxx of the Philadelphia athletics in 1932 was the Only slugger to reach the s8-Homer Mark. On thursday night West Germany s Boris Becker easily advanced into the semifinals of the . Open Tennis championships crushing Czechoslovakia s Milan Grejber 6-3, 6-2,6-1. Becker the reigning Wimbledon Champion will Lake on another Czecho slovak 16th-seeded Miloslav Mecir in saturday s semifinals. The other semifinal will pit yet another czechoslovak defending Champion and top seeded Ivan Len against fourth seeded Stefan Edberg of Sweden. Earlier thursday Mecir eliminated no. 7 Joakim Nystrom of Sweden 6-4, 6 2,3-6., 6-2.the women s singles semifinal on Friday will Send top seeded Navratilova seeking her third . Open title in four Yean against no. 3 Steffi Graf of West Germany and no. 2 Evert Lloyd a six time Winner of America s Premier Tennis event against no. 7 Sutkova. Becker seeded third in the 128-Plavcr men s singles Field had no problems with his 6-foot-b opponent who was Booe repeatedly for his uninspired Effort. Grejber the tallest player in professional Tennis repeatedly let Becker s passing shots sail by without even lifting his Racket or attempting to or for the Ball one of Only two unseeded players to reach the quarterfinals Grejber spent the entire match hitting his volleys Long or into the net when he did make a Effort to go for the Ball. Several times Becker hit weak service returns across the net Only to see Grejber look at the Ball turn around and walk Back to the Baseline to serve the next Point. At the end of the third set i looked at the scoreboard and it said. 6-3. 6-2, 4 0 " Becker said. And i said. What the hell is going on this is a quarterfinal match in the third set. The crowd cheered Grejber every time he won a Point. They did t cheer  was billed As a Battle of big servers. It turned into a big Yawn. Becker finished the 81-minute blow out with three aces while Grejber had iwo. Grejber won just 13 Points in the second set and 14 in the third. The fans paid much Money to see the match Becker said. But it s too difficult to win a match and you have to play 100 percent. He s a pretty strange Guy off the court and i Don t think Many players talk to him Becker said of Grejber. Grejber did t want to talk much after the match last Lime t won now i lost Grejber said. He s a Good  it is the third Lime the 18-year-old Becker has reached the semifinal of a grand slam tournament.
